秸秆还田技术应用发展现状与前景分析 被引量:11

摘要 从实际情况出发,详细论述了秸秆还田对土壤状况的改善与提高,并阐述了影响秸秆还田的关键因素,分析了秸秆还田技术发展趋势,阐述并指出了秸秆还田技术是发展现代农业的一项重要措施。其发展前景广阔,潜力巨大。
